Backflow Preventer Installation Price Ranges in Temecula, CA
Typical costs for backflow preventer installation in Temecula, CA, generally fall within a certain range depending on project specifics. The overall price can vary based on factors such as system size, complexity, and site conditions.
$500 - $1,200 (Basic residential installation)
$1,200 - $2,500 (Commercial or larger systems)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Residential Backflow Preventer | $500 - $1,200 |
| Commercial Backflow Preventer | $1,200 - $2,500 |
| Existing System Replacement | $800 - $2,000 |
| New Construction Installation | $1,500 - $3,000 |
| System Upgrades or Additions | $700 - $2,000 |
What affects the cost of Backflow Preventer Installation
Understanding the factors that influence the cost of backflow preventer installation can help in planning and comparing options in Temecula, CA. Several elements can impact the overall project expenses, including materials, scope, and permitting requirements.
- Materials used: The type and quality of backflow preventer chosen, such as reduced-pressure zone (RPZ) devices or double-check valves, can affect costs.
- Size and scope of the system: Larger or more complex installations, such as those serving multiple properties or extensive irrigation systems, may require additional materials and labor.
- Labor complexity: Site accessibility, existing plumbing configurations, and installation challenges influence labor time and costs.
- Permitting and inspections: Local regulations in Temecula may require permits and inspections, which can add to the overall project expenses.
- Additional components or services: Extras like backflow testing, system upgrades, or integration with existing plumbing can impact total costs.
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Small (up to 2 inches) | $500 - $1,200 |
| Medium (2-4 inches) | $1,200 - $2,500 |
| Large (4-6 inches) | $2,500 - $4,500 |
| Extra Large (over 6 inches) | $4,500 - $8,000 |
In Temecula, CA, project costs for backflow preventer installation can vary based on scope and size, influenced by local labor and material rates.
